Major Management Priorities

The HHS OIG has identified the top management and performance challenges for 2022.  HHS management is committed to working toward resolving these challenges.  The performance measures in this document track such challenges safeguarding public health, ensuring the financial integrity of HHS programs, delivering value, quality and improved outcomes in Medicare and Medicaid, protecting the health and safety of HHS beneficiaries, harnessing data to improve the health and well-being of individuals, and improving collaboration to better serve our Nation.  In addition, HHS employs a robust program integrity process.  For further information about these challenges, please read the HHS 2022 Top Management and Performance Challenges.
